The MAPKKK Ste11 regulates vegetative growth through a kinase cascade of shared signaling components.
Proceedings of the National Academy of Sciences of the United States of America - 26 Oct 1999
Lee B N, Elion E A
Abstract excerpt
In haploid Saccharomyces cerevisiae, the mating and invasive growth (IG) pathways use the same mitogen-activated protein kinase kinase kinase kinase (MAPKKKK, Ste20), MAPKKK (Ste11), MAPKK (Ste7), and transcription factor (Ste12) to promote either G(1) arrest and fusion or foraging in response to distinct stimuli.
